Core Insights - RAAAM Memory Technologies has completed an oversubscribed $17.5 million Series A funding round, led by NXP Semiconductors, with total funding exceeding $24 million [3][4] - The funding will support the comprehensive certification of RAAAM's patented on-chip memory technology, GCRAM, at leading foundries [4] - GCRAM technology aims to reduce area by up to 50% and power consumption by up to 10 times compared to high-density SRAM, while being compatible with standard CMOS processes [4] Funding and Investment - The Series A funding round attracted various strategic and financial investors, indicating strong confidence in RAAAM's revolutionary technology [4] - RAAAM's CEO highlighted the importance of this funding in accelerating collaborations with leading semiconductor companies and aligning with customer product roadmaps [4] Technology and Market Impact - GCRAM is designed to address memory bottlenecks in advanced AI chips by significantly increasing memory density and reducing power consumption [4] - The technology can be manufactured using standard CMOS processes, allowing chip manufacturers to adopt it without costly redesigns [4] - The European Innovation Council Fund supports RAAAM's breakthroughs in on-chip memory, addressing a critical challenge in the semiconductor value chain [5]
